Peaceful and gentle pet euthanasia carried out where you and your best friend are most comfortable. All home euthanasia includes a gentle sedation to make sure your pet is calm and comfortable before they are put to sleep peacefully.
If you are unsure whether it is time to consider putting your pet to sleep, we offer a Quality of Life Assessment & Health Check. During this we will discuss your queries and concerns and help advise you about timing your pets euthanasia. We can return at an appropriate time to give your friend a peaceful goodbye.
We can help you to arrange pet cremation with return of ashes if you desire. We are also happy if you prefer to make your own arrangements
Determining the appropriate time can be challenging. Signs may include chronic pain, loss of appetite, or decreased quality of life. Our veterinarians can assess your pet’s condition and help guide you through this decision.
This is one of the hardest decisions any pet owner will ever make. If you’re unsure, our mobile veterinary team can visit your home to assess your pet’s pain levels, mobility, and quality of life. We’ll talk openly and honestly about what we see, offering advice that balances medical understanding with compassion. You’ll never be pressured, only supported to make the choice that feels right for you and your beloved companion.

Once your pet has passed, we give you as much time as you need to say goodbye. We can help you arrange cremation, collect ashes, or offer guidance if you prefer to handle arrangements yourself. Many owners choose to keep a paw print, a lock of fur, or a sympathy card as a personal memory. Whatever you decide, our team will guide you through each step gently and respectfully.
Choose a quiet, comfortable space in your home where your pet feels safe. Have their favorite blanket or toy nearby. This setting helps facilitate a peaceful euthanasia experience.
